Having balance and strength issues with left leg

Male/29/264lbs/6"2'/b315s405d510 lifting for 7 years
I am having issues with my left leg regarding balance and strength. This occurs when I am doing one leg toe touches, dumbbell step ups, or leg ext. I am sure it is hurting my other other lifts as well and creating imbalances. I believe the issue stems from an injury I sustained about 10 years ago to my left knee. Dr said there is nothing that can be done for it now or for awhile but I will be getting my knee replaced later on. I was told I have a build up of arthritis in the left knee.
Is anyone else fought with this and had success? I'd be happy with any improvements period. I nelegeled building my core and balance when I started lifting and I think it may be time to break it down to the basics with single leg movements and core work.
Any tips, tricks, or input would be greatly appreciated

Have you ever sought physical therapy? I had the same issue with my left side/knee, which caused issues both running and lifting. With physical therapy, I was given the correct, basic exercises to strengthen the leg. I can't say the problem is completely gone, nor will it ever be, but it helped the discomfort and pain.0
